Key Driving Factors

Highway and Roadway Infrastructure Investment

Growth of the polymer modified bitumen market is strongly tied to global trends in highway and roadway infrastructure development. In countries with burgeoning economies, such as India and China, governments are significantly investing in infrastructure improvements to facilitate local and international trade. Polymer modified bitumen is a key material for constructing and repairing roads due to its superior waterproofing properties and high resistance to thermal cracking and rutting. Therefore, as governments increasingly invest in highway projects, the need for durable materials like polymer modified bitumen will parallelly rise, impacting the market positively.

Climate Change and Infrastructure Resilience

The current shift towards sustainability and climate resilience in building and construction techniques worldwide is another driving factor. Climate change predictions have catalyzed an urgency to construct infrastructure that can sustain severe weather conditions. Polymer modified bitumen, due to its elasticity, durability and resistance to heavy loads, fits well into the picture as it can endure harsh weather extremes, high temperature variations, and heavy vehicular traffic. Consequently, the global need to develop resilient infrastructure to cope with climate change has brought increased momentum to the polymer modified bitumen market.

Market Evolution by Timeline

2019-2023
During this period, the automotive and construction industries in Asia-Pacific significantly propelled demand for Polymer Modified Bitumen (PMB). This was primarily driven by infrastructure development in countries like India and China. At the supply end, suppliers primarily offered Styrene-Butadiene-Styrene (SBS) type PMBs due to easy processability and superior performance at high temperatures. Structurally, contracts were primarily long-term to manage price volatility in crude oil, the base raw material. The California Department of Transportation (Caltrans) began implementing PG grading standard for PMB. This regulation increased the compatibility and performance of PMB, fostering its adoption. However, the major challenge has been the high cost compared to other binder materials, limiting its widespread use.
2024
In 2024, market dynamics were influenced by the surge in road paving applications in North America and Europe. The use of PMB in pavement construction improved durability, reducing the frequency of road repairs. Suppliers continued their preference toward SBS due to its high-temperature resistance and cost-effectiveness. Large scale road infrastructure projects in these regions led to fixed-price contracts with manufacturers. The implementation of strict European standards, like EN 14023, assured the quality of PMB, thereby enhancing its implementation. Nevertheless, procuring recyclable polymers was a challenge, pushing companies towards strategic partnerships with waste management firms.
